UEFA has apologised for running out of winners medals during the Europa League final trophy ceremony on Wednesday after more Tottenham Hotspur players than expected lined up to receive their individual prizes.
Tottenham were crowned 2025 UEFA Europa League champions after a 1-0 victory over Manchester United at San Mamés Stadium in Spain.

Tottenham beat Manchester United 1-0 to win the Europa League final and lift its first European trophy in more than four decades.
Manchester United Plc shares are set for their steepest drop in more than eight months after the football club lost an all-or-nothing Europa League final against English rival Tottenham Hotspur.
United took a more adventurous route to the final, beating Real Sociedad before pulling off a spectacular comeback against Lyon and then comprehensively beating an Athletic Club side who'd been dreaming of a home European final. United curiously remain the only unbeaten side across European competition this season.
